    Julián Arcas (1832-1882) was a Spanish classical guitarist and composer with a sizeable amount of output for classical guitar. He influenced Francisco Tárrega and Antonio de Torres both in terms of technique and composition making him an important figure in Spanish guitar music in the 19th century.
